The best batteries-included self-hosted Iceberg REST catalog, with excellent security, dynamic warehouse management, fine-grained authorization, credential vending, soft-delete, a useful UI, and straightforward deployment.
Grok Lightweight Rust-native REST catalog, excellent fine-grained auth (OPA/OpenFGA), audit events, low footprint/K8s-friendly for self-hosted governance-focused deployments; strong Trino integration and performance for typical practitioner self-managed Iceberg lakes.
Claude A fast, single-binary Rust implementation of the Iceberg REST spec with Postgres backing, OpenFGA-based authorization, and Kubernetes-friendly operations — the best value for small-to-mid teams that want a production Iceberg catalog without JVM operational weight; assumption: you want self-hosted simplicity over ecosystem breadth.
Gemini A lightweight, high-performance, Rust-native implementation of the Apache Iceberg REST Catalog spec. It offers low memory overhead, modern security via OpenFGA, and is ideal for organizations running Kubernetes who want to avoid heavy JVM/Python-based deployment footprints.
Where Lakekeeper falls short, per the models
- GPT It is younger and less institutionally established than Polaris, and some operational features require Lakekeeper Plus.
- Claude Small community and young project relative to Apache-governed peers — long-term maintenance rests on a small vendor (Vakamo), a real bus-factor risk for conservative enterprises.
- Gemini As a relatively young project, it lacks the massive community backing, extensive ecosystem integrations, and lineage tracking features of Apache Polaris or Unity Catalog.
- Grok Narrower scope (primarily Iceberg REST, less federation breadth) and smaller community/ecosystem than Polaris.
Top alternatives per the models: Apache Polaris · Apache Gravitino · Nessie · Unity Catalog
